Liquidity pools are a relatively new concept in the world of blockchain and cryptocurrencies, but they are quickly becoming an integral part of decentralized exchanges (DEXs). In this article, we will explore what liquidity pools are, how they work, and the benefits they offer traders and investors.
First, let’s define what a liquidity pool is. A liquidity pool is a collection of assets, typically cryptocurrencies, made available for trading on a DEX. These assets are provided by different users and when a trader wants to buy or sell a specific asset, they can do so using the assets in the liquidity pool as a counterparty. This enables trading without the need for a central intermediary and allows for greater decentralization and transparency in the trading process.
In a traditional centralized exchange, the exchange acts as the counterparty for every trade and is responsible for providing liquidity. However, there is no central intermediary in a DEX and traders must provide their own liquidity for trading to take place. This is where liquidity pools come into play. They provide the necessary liquidity to trade on a DEX, and in return, liquidity providers receive rewards for their contributions.
One of the main advantages of liquidity pools is that they can help reduce the volatility of prices for a given asset. This is because having a large pool of assets available for trading means that a single large order is less likely to have a significant impact on price. Also, since the assets in a liquidity pool are typically provided by multiple users, there is less risk of a single point of failure in the trading process.
There are two main types of liquidity pools: Automated Market Maker (AMM) pools and order book pools.
AMM pools use a mathematical formula called the “AMM algorithm” to price assets. This algorithm takes into account the size of the liquidity pool and the relative amounts of different assets in the pool. The most popular AMM algorithm is Uniswap, which uses a constant product formula to calculate an asset’s price.
Order book pools, on the other hand, rely on the traditional order book model used in centralized exchanges. Traders can place limit orders to buy or sell assets at a specific price and these orders will be matched with other orders to execute trades.
Both AMM and order book pools have their own pros and cons. AMM pools are generally considered to be more decentralized and less prone to manipulation, but may not be as efficient in terms of price discovery as order book pools. Order book pools can provide a more accurate picture of market sentiment and can be more efficient in terms of price discovery, but they are more centralized and potentially more susceptible to manipulation.
